About Arena GlobalFX
Arena GlobalFX is not authorised by the UK’s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) and has been explicitly issued a warning by the FCA indicating that it may be providing financial services or products in the UK without authorisation. The firm uses the domain arenaglobal.asia and provides an address of “2 Frederick Street, Kings Cross, London, WC1X 0ND,” which may be misleading. The FCA warning emphasises that clients would have no access to the Financial Ombudsman Service or the Financial Services Compensation Scheme.
No regulatory licences or registrations from any recognised authorities (such as FCA, ASIC, CySEC, BaFin, etc.) have been found in the firm’s public disclosures, indicating that Arena GlobalFX operates without any formal licence. Independent monitoring services categorise the broker as unregulated and advise against engaging with it.
Pros and cons
Cons
- No regulatory authorisation or licensing has been confirmed.
- FCA has issued a formal warning, classifying the firm as unauthorised.
- Clients lack access to dispute resolution mechanisms such as the Financial Ombudsman Service or compensation schemes.
